JOB DESCRIPTION: WELDING QC INSPECTOR The proposed Welding QC Inspectors shall meet as a minimum the following requirements: a) QC welding inspectors shall be certified to CSWIP 3.1 or 3.2 or AWS b) Basic engineering degree or diploma and Eight (8) years of working experience in the Oil and gas industry of which Six (6) years must be in the Onshore and Offshore Oil & Gas Pipelines Projects c) Verifying all Contractor and subcontractor equipment is calibrated and daily / per shift checks are conducted as per approved project procedures. d) Monitoring all welding parameters during qualification and production to ensure compliance with Project WPS’s. e) Reviewing ITPs f) Preparing RFIs as per ITPs g) Preparing NDT requests and witnessing NDT activities as required. h) Final sentencing of production joints with Company Inspectors in accordance with approved Project pipeline Acceptance Criteria. i) j) Pipe Identification and Tally sheets. Compiling Qualification NDT reports and manufacturing records for the MDR. k) A deep understanding of QA/QC related regulations data sheet codes and standards such as: AWS ASME BS EN API ASTM DNV. l) Level II NDT (RT UT MPT PT) m) CRA Pipelines welding experience. (Desirable) n) Desirable experience on pipelines Mechanize / Automatic Welding o) Familiar with SMAW GTAW GMAW PIN BRAZING Welding process. p) Knowledge of welding datalogger parameter recording.
